Cancer is clearly a very serious disease and affects millions of people every day. If you have learned you have cancer, you already know what kind of things that you can do to treat it medically. However it's important that you have a positive outlook and a positive mindset during this time. Here are just a few of the ways that you can do that.
Cut out the stress in your life. This may not be possible for all of your stresses, but do what you can to get rid of as much stress as possible. That means that it's important for you to stop surrounding yourself with toxic people, for example. It may also be time for you to quit your job. Cancer has a way of making your life making you examine your life, and when you do that, you will feel stronger.
Learn specific relaxation techniques. Most adults have trouble relaxing, and when you have cancer it is more important than ever that you learn to relax. You may decide to take up deep breathing exercises, yoga or meditation for example. These relaxation techniques may not work right away, but make sure to give them at least two or three weeks to work before moving on to something else. This can be a way for you to relax in spite of your disease.
Another way to deal with your mind during cancer is to have a journal. In this journal you can write your feelings about your disease, but you can also do more than that. You can make it a journal about your whole life. You can note the positive things that are happening your life as well as any thoughts you have about your cancer. You will find that a journal filled with positive things and gratitude lifts your spirits enough for you to be able to go on.
Try to talk to people who are supportive. Just a short chat with someone who supports you and cares about you can be enough to make your whole day worthwhile. That is even more true when you have cancer. Your loved ones are there to listen to your feelings and want to do that for you. Try to do something with your friends or family members at least once a week, so that you are distracted from thinking about your disease and enjoy yourself at the same time.
Consider reading religious and philosophical texts. You may not be a religious person, but you might find that during a difficult time, such as when dealing with cancer, that some texts are soothing to you. You can also read philosophical texts or stories by people who have had cancer and triumphed over it. These words can help you to express what you cannot, and they may help you to feel better.
A positive mindset is very helpful because you can better handle your disease when you are coming at it from a positive standpoint. Use these tips to help you keep yourself positive while you fight cancer.
